0 支持
312 閲覧
(180 ポイント) Q&A
キャラクターアニメーションをするにあたり親子関係を作ろうと思ったのですが、一つ質問させてください。

仕様上、親となるレイヤーは必ず子よりも後ろになるのでしょうか?

女の子のキャラクターに首をかしげる動きをさせようと思っています。

動かすにあたり、後ろ髪や髪飾り、目や口などを、親となる「頭」レイヤーの子にしようと思いました。

目や口などは「頭」より前側のレイヤーでいいのですが、たとえば「後ろ髪」レイヤーは「頭」レイヤーよりも後ろに設定したいです。

この場合、「後ろ髪」レイヤーなどの、重ねた際一番下になるレイヤーを親とし、そのレイヤーの原点の位置をあごの位置に変更するなどして制作するのでしょうか?(親子関係の親となるレイヤーを、子よりも前のレイヤー位置にすることは不可能ですか?)

(追伸)送信させていただいてから思いましたが、親を「頭」レイヤーにすることにこだわらなくてもいいのかもしれないです・・・

しかし親を「頭」にするとレイヤー一覧を見たときわかりやすいので、もし可能だったらそうならないかなと思い質問させていただきました。

文章が下手ですみません、ご回答よろしくお願いいたします。
このページをシェアする

回答 1

0 支持
(3.1k ポイント)
OPTPiX ユーザーサポート 大野です。
 

ご質問の件ですが、”優先度”アトリビュートを使用することでパーツの前後関係をコントロールすることができますので、こちらを確認いただけたらと思います。

・”優先度”は+の値が入るほど手前に表示され、-の値になるほど奥に表示されます。

・優先度はOPTPiX SpriteStudio Ver.6の場合は9999~-9999の間で設定が可能です。必ず綺麗に1234…というように1並びの必要はありません。(あとでパーツを並び替える時のためにわざと数字に隙間を開けておくのも良いかと思います)

・優先度に何も設定しないときは一律0の値になり、表示順はリストの並びに依存します。

・基本的には0フレームで全てのパーツに対し優先度を設定しておくことをお勧めします。(ゲームエンジンなどで利用する場合は優先度が設定されていない場合、正常に表示できない場合がございます)

”優先度”アトリビュートで解決できない場合は再度お問い合わせいただけましたら幸いです。

ご確認よろしくお願いいたします。
(180 ポイント)
夜分遅くにご回答いただきありがとうございます。

久々に使用したため「優先度」の存在を失念しておりました、、大変助かりました!

また質問させていただくかもしれませんがその際はよろしくお願いいたします。
...